An Equal Playing Field for All AgesOne of the greatest virtues of foosball is its universal accessibility. Unlike complex board games that require hours of rule reading or video games that favor experienced players, foosball is intuitive. A young child can grasp the basic concept of spinning a rod just as easily as a grandparent can. This makes it the ultimate multi-generational equalizer for family gatherings or lazy weekends when everyone is stuck inside together.

While the basics are simple, the game offers a surprisingly deep learning curve for those looking to master it. Beginners rely on chaotic, enthusiastic spinning, hoping for a lucky deflection. As players spend more time at the table, they begin to develop genuine strategy. They learn to control the ball with the midfield line, pass precisely to their forwards, and execute targeted bank shots off the wall. This progression from random luck to skilled coordination keeps the game endlessly engaging, ensuring that no two matches ever feel exactly the same.

The Physics of Fast-Paced FunAt its core, foosball is a beautiful display of physical mechanics and geometry. Every match is a lesson in angles, velocity, and reaction time. Players must constantly analyze the positioning of their opponent’s plastic figures while simultaneously managing their own defensive line. The speed of the game forces split-second decision-making, sharpening mental focus and hand-eye coordination in a way that few other indoor activities can match.

The physical setup of the table enhances this sensory experience. The smooth green surface, the sturdy wooden or metal frame, and the ergonomic handles all contribute to a satisfying tactile loop. There is a distinct auditory joy unique to the game: the hollow rattle of the ball entering the goal box, the sliding of the scoring beads, and the friendly banter between competitors. These sounds combine to create an atmosphere of pure, unfiltered recreation that completely isolates players from the dreary weather outside.
